The best way to find a cheap train ticket from Lichfield to Newcastle is to book your journey as far in advance as possible and to avoid travelling at rush hour.
The average ticket from Lichfield to Newcastle will cost around £90 if you buy it on the day, but you can find cheap train tickets today for only £54.
To travel from Lichfield to Newcastle you need to make at least one change.

Newcastle train station facilities and services
Newcastle has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Shopping, Parking, Dining, ATM, Taxis, Accessibility, WC, Hotel, Lounge, Lost and Found Office, Ticket Office,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ental and Information Desk.
Food and drink
Food options include: Caffè Nero, Costa Coffee, Pumpkin Cafe Shop, AMT Coffee, Burger King, The Centurion, Destination 1850, Pasta Station
Wi-Fi and ATMs
Free Wi-Fi available in the station. ATMs are the ATM is located within the main station building.
Tickets and information
The ticket office is open Mon - Sat: 05:00 - 21:20, Sun: 07:30 - 21:20. Information desks are information desk is available in the main station building on the concourse.
Luggage and lost property
Lost and found is available at the station.
Parking, taxis and toilets
Available at Newcastle: Parking, Taxis, WC.
Bike and car services
Available at Newcastle: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ental.
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Newcastle: Step-free access throughout station, elevators, accessible ticket machine, wheelchairs available.
Shops, hotels and contact
Nearby hotels include The County Hotel, Newcastle, Hampton by Hilton Newcastle, Royal Station Hotel.
